diff options
author | Anna Henningsen <anna@addaleax.net> | 2018-12-15 21:13:44 +0100 |
---|---|---|
committer | Daniel Bevenius <daniel.bevenius@gmail.com> | 2018-12-20 07:23:55 +0100 |
commit | 6b7816e22beb74624675c22145032c4767cb1cda (patch) | |
tree | 7d79eade82e8f19ab5cdd008dfc0aed31df2438e /src/node_options.cc | |
parent | e5966ef60c24609c1bd716742836dc40be64db0b (diff) | |
download | android-node-v8-6b7816e22beb74624675c22145032c4767cb1cda.tar.gz android-node-v8-6b7816e22beb74624675c22145032c4767cb1cda.tar.bz2 android-node-v8-6b7816e22beb74624675c22145032c4767cb1cda.zip |
src: mark options parsers as const
These do not change their contents after being constructed.
PR-URL: https://github.com/nodejs/node/pull/25065
Reviewed-By: Colin Ihrig <cjihrig@gmail.com>
Reviewed-By: Joyee Cheung <joyeec9h3@gmail.com>
Reviewed-By: James M Snell <jasnell@gmail.com>
Diffstat (limited to 'src/node_options.cc')
-rw-r--r-- | src/node_options.cc |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/src/node_options.cc b/src/node_options.cc index ef80971461..d665bc4040 100644 --- a/src/node_options.cc +++ b/src/node_options.cc @@ -88,7 +88,7 @@ DebugOptionsParser::DebugOptionsParser() { } #if HAVE_INSPECTOR -DebugOptionsParser DebugOptionsParser::instance; +const DebugOptionsParser DebugOptionsParser::instance; #endif // HAVE_INSPECTOR EnvironmentOptionsParser::EnvironmentOptionsParser() { @@ -218,7 +218,7 @@ EnvironmentOptionsParser::EnvironmentOptionsParser() { #endif // HAVE_INSPECTOR } -EnvironmentOptionsParser EnvironmentOptionsParser::instance; +const EnvironmentOptionsParser EnvironmentOptionsParser::instance; PerIsolateOptionsParser::PerIsolateOptionsParser() { AddOption("--track-heap-objects", @@ -241,7 +241,7 @@ PerIsolateOptionsParser::PerIsolateOptionsParser() { &PerIsolateOptions::get_per_env_options); } -PerIsolateOptionsParser PerIsolateOptionsParser::instance; +const PerIsolateOptionsParser PerIsolateOptionsParser::instance; PerProcessOptionsParser::PerProcessOptionsParser() { AddOption("--title", @@ -345,7 +345,7 @@ PerProcessOptionsParser::PerProcessOptionsParser() { &PerProcessOptions::get_per_isolate_options); } -PerProcessOptionsParser PerProcessOptionsParser::instance; +const PerProcessOptionsParser PerProcessOptionsParser::instance; inline std::string RemoveBrackets(const std::string& host) { if (!host.empty() && host.front() == '[' && host.back() == ']') |